About Shao-Fei Sun
Shao-Fei Sun is a scholar working on Biomedical Engineering, Biomaterials, Plant Science, Materials Chemistry and Organic Chemistry, having authored 18 papers that have together received 432 indexed citations. Recurring topics across this work include Advanced Cellulose Research Studies (6 papers), Lignin and Wood Chemistry (5 papers), Biofuel production and bioconversion (4 papers), Nanomaterials for catalytic reactions (3 papers), Advanced Photocatalysis Techniques (3 papers), Adsorption and biosorption for pollutant removal (3 papers), Polysaccharides and Plant Cell Walls (3 papers) and Enzyme-mediated dye degradation (2 papers). The work is most often cited by research in Biomaterials (109 citations), Renewable Energy, Sustainability and the Environment (112 citations), Biomedical Engineering (218 citations), Polymers and Plastics (55 citations) and Water Science and Technology (42 citations). Shao-Fei Sun has collaborated with scholars based in China, Chile and United States. Frequent co-authors include Zhengjun Shi, Jing Yang, Haiyan Yang, Run‐Cang Sun, Jiliang Ma, Xiaopan Yang, Jia Deng, D. Wang, Zhendong Liu and Ling‐Ping Xiao. Their work appears in journals such as International Journal of Biological Macromolecules, Industrial Crops and Products, Green Chemistry, Separation and Purification Technology and Carbohydrate Polymers.
